The Jews of Moldova Petitioned the Residents of the Country, Citing the Rabbani of Mashkov ZIA.

Summary by kikar.co.il
On the 21st of Sivan, the day of Hilula Kadisha of the miraculous Kabbalist, Rabbi Shabtai of Mashkov, one of the greatest disciples of the holy Baal Shem Tov and author of the "Sidur Rabbi Shabtai", crowds of Moldovan Jews responded to the call of the Chief Rabbi of the country, the rabbi of the state, Rabbi Pinchas Salzman, and made an aliyah to his holy Zion, in order to continue the tradition of the last years of aliyah to Zion.
